About Us

Hudson Partners’ seven professionals work as a team on every assignment. Each member adds a unique, highly developed set of perspectives, insights, experiences, and skills to the fundraising process.

Hudson Partners has a flat hierarchy, keeping lines of communication short and fluid, facilitating the flow of ideas, and maintaining momentum during the fundraising process. Enhancing Hudson Partners’ approach is the firm’s practice of focusing on a small number of fundraising assignments each year for managers with non-conflicting investment strategies.

Hudson Partners’ professionals are in continuous contact with members of the investment community, gauging trends and tracking investor activity. This investor information is compiled daily and shared across the firm, providing clients with unparalleled market insights that enable them to react quickly to investor interests and requests. Hudson Partners’ deep knowledge of the institutional investor market is also drawn from extensive buy-side experience gained while some of the principals were part of major investment management firms.

Hudson Partners provides access to a broad range of investors throughout the United States, Canada, Europe, Greater China, the Middle East, and other select regions. In addition to primary investments, the firm also arranges for co-investments alongside investment management firms that serve as lead investors.

Investors include financial institutions, public and corporate pension funds, endowments and foundations, advisors and consultants, funds-of-funds, insurance companies, and large family offices.
